Also, I think the context is very important, i.e., laying the groundwork vs. something coming out of absolutely nowhere. What might make total sense in one story where the former has been done might transform into "oh my god, I did not need to read that" in another if it just drops out of the sky. I have a plot point in what I'm currently writing that I can't imagine the story without, now--this is why I sarcastically told my boss I shouldn't be allowed to roll pasta, it's such a soothing task where you can just stand and daydream--laying certain foundations already, but the scene itself doesn't need to be included. The fact that the opening is going to be included, characters will remember and reference it, etc., is enough. (And my plot is already way over quota on the gratuitious pain and suffering.) Maybe explore a route like that if you're really uncertain?
